Vulnerability details
The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to perform CSRF attack.
The weakness exists due to insufficient CSRF protections. A remote attacker can create a specially crafted HTML page or URL, trick the victim into visiting it, gain access to the system and perform arbitrary actions.
Successful exploitation of the vulnerability may allow a remote attacker to perform harmful SQL operations such as renaming databases, creating new tables/routines, deleting designer pages, adding/deleting users, updating user passwords, killing SQL processes, etc.

How to mitigate CVE-2018-19969
Update to version 4.8.4.
phpMyAdmin - update to 4.8.4
phpmyadmin (Alpine package) - addressed in versions 4.8.4-r0, 4.8.5-r0
